Python获取单个字符的实现流程

流程图

flowchart TD
    A(开始)
    B{输入字符序列}
    C{检查输入是否为空}
    D[获取单个字符]
    E(结束)

    A-->B
    B-->C
    C-->|是| E
    C-->|否| D
    D-->E

步骤说明

下面是实现获取单个字符的具体步骤:

步骤 代码 说明
1 input_string = input("请输入字符序列:") 通过input函数获取用户输入的字符序列
2 if input_string: 判断输入是否为空,如果不为空则继续执行下一步
3 char = input_string[0] 使用索引操作符获取字符序列中的第一个字符,索引从0开始,赋值给变量char
4 print("获取到的单个字符为:", char) 打印获取到的单个字符

代码实现

下面是完整代码及解释:

# 步骤1:获取用户输入的字符序列
input_string = input("请输入字符序列:")

代码解释:使用input函数获取用户输入的字符序列,并将其赋值给变量input_string。

# 步骤2:检查输入是否为空
if input_string:
    # 步骤3:获取单个字符
    char = input_string[0]
    # 步骤4:打印获取到的单个字符
    print("获取到的单个字符为:", char)

代码解释:判断输入的字符序列是否为空,如果不为空,则执行步骤3和步骤4。步骤3中,使用索引操作符[0]获取字符序列中的第一个字符,并将其赋值给变量char。步骤4中,使用print函数打印获取到的单个字符。

完整代码

# 步骤1:获取用户输入的字符序列
input_string = input("请输入字符序列:")

# 步骤2:检查输入是否为空
if input_string:
    # 步骤3:获取单个字符
    char = input_string[0]
    # 步骤4:打印获取到的单个字符
    print("获取到的单个字符为:", char)

以上就是实现获取单个字符的完整流程和代码。通过以上步骤,我们可以实现获取字符序列中的第一个字符,并将其打印出来。希望这篇文章对你有帮助!